The Volcano



for many years the volcano has been asleep

then all of a sudden

it decides to  wake up

with a mighty explosion

it erupts

sending out  a thick cloud of  ash  into the sky

 with in minutes, the sun disappears

turning day into night

 hot molten rock 

spills out from the top and begins to flow

soon a river of lava is formed

it’s path is deadly

for any thing in that gets in the way will be destroyed

this  is a volcano that will show’s no mercy
